Not like it was
I registered for this china and have loved it for years. when one dinner plate broke I rushed to replace it. Unfortunately, these plates are lower quality now than they were before. They are thicker and heavier than they were originally. I suspect they now have more stone in them, making them cheaper to manufacture but lowering the quality. Also, the dishes no longer say "bone china" on the bottom as they once did, which I find really suspicious. Disappointed in the decline.
